July is Shark Month, and there has never been a better time to get to know these ancient and well-adapted titans of the sea! Scuba divers everywhere are invited to learn more about sharks and participate in their protection by taking the PADI AWARE Shark Conservation Specialty course.

This course explores the factors that make sharks particularly vulnerable to threats despite their power, and their role in ensuring a healthy and balanced ocean ecosystem. Learn about shark biology and how you can help protect these misunderstood creatures. Even more exciting? Just in time for World Oceans Day (June 8), PADI AWARE launched its brand-new Conservation Action Portal. This one-stop digital hub makes it simple to take real conservation action—whether you’re in a wetsuit or on Wi-Fi.

From signing petitions to tracking global impact on the interactive Impact Map, this new platform makes it easy to get involved. Use your PADI single sign-on to track your activities, earn badges and become part of the world’s largest underwater movement. And keep your eyes peeled—this summer the Global Shark & Ray Census is launching through the portal. So, gear up, get involved and help protect our ocean’s most iconic predators.
